windows下配置多redis例項

2021-08-20 12:33:44 字數 1119 閱讀 3379

由於多個專案需要使用redis服務,所以需要在1臺windows伺服器上部署多個redis例項並將例項安裝成windows服務,下面介紹步驟,部署3個例項

1、將redis.windows-service.conf複製改名為

redis.windows-service-6380.conf

redis.windows-service-6381.conf

redis.windows-service-6382.conf

2、分別修改這三個配置檔案中的配置屬性,以6380埠的例項為例,屬性分別為

# 本地資料庫名稱

dbfilename dump-6380.rdb

# 日誌檔案

logfile "logs/server_log_6380.txt"

# 日誌輸出

syslog-enabled yes

# 登入認證密碼,三個例項可設定為一樣的,推薦分別設定

requirepass 123456

然後分別再修改其他2個例項的對應屬性,目前我只用到這4個

3、啟動cmd命令列,執行

redis-server.exe --service-install redis.windows-service-6380.conf --service-name redis6380 --port 6380
建立後服務並未自動啟動,執行

redis-server.exe --service-start --service-name redis6380
當然也可以到windows服務中手動啟動

4、檢查日誌檔案是否正常建立,然後分別建立其他2個例項的服務

5、cmd執行命令測試登入

redis-cli.exe -h 127.0.0.1 -p 6380

若設定了requirepass 在登入後執行 auth 《密碼》進行認證

6、若需要刪除例項服務則執行

redis-server.exe --service-uninstall --service-name redis6380

windows環境下配置php和redis

redis 是完全開源免費的,遵守bsd協議,是乙個高效能的key value資料庫。如 c reids開啟乙個cmd視窗 使用cd命令切換目錄到 c redis 執行 redis server.exe redis.conf如果想方便的話,可以把redis的路徑加到系統的環境變數裡,這樣就省得再輸路...

windows環境下配置php和redis

redis 是完全開源免費的,遵守bsd協議,是乙個高效能的key value資料庫。如 c reids開啟乙個cmd視窗 使用cd命令切換目錄到 c redis 執行 redis server.exe redis.conf如果想方便的話,可以把redis的路徑加到系統的環境變數裡,這樣就省得再輸路...

windows下安裝redis和redis擴充套件

開啟乙個 cmd 視窗 使用cd命令切換目錄到 c redis 執行 redis server.exe redis.windows.conf 如果想方便的話,可以把 redis 的路徑加到系統的環境變數裡,這樣就省得再輸路徑了,後面的那個 redis.windows.conf 可以省略,如果省略,會...